Super Eagles Captain and Tianjin TEDA midfielder, John Obi Mikel will miss the remainder of the Chinese Super League season due to injury. Ayo Olu Ibidapo of the Communication Department of the Nigeria Football Federation NFF confirmed the report. Mikel featured in 18 CSL matches this season and scored twoContinue Reading

President Nigeria Football Federation (NFF), Amaju Pinnick has declared that Super Eagles head coach Gernot Rohr cannot continue to decide which stadium should host the team’s international home games.
